Today In History

By From http://www.musingsoverapint.com/ • Mar 16th, 2012 • Category: Blog Entries.Local

On March 16, 1780 George Washington issued a General Order granting St. Patrick’s Day as a holiday for the Continental Army.

George Washington’s General Order of March 16, 1780, granting Saint Patrick’s Day as a holiday to the troops
